<h2><u>Question :-</u></h2>

In which number does 7 represent 10 times the value that it represents in 167 300.

<h3>____________________</h3>

<h2><u>Solution :-</u></h2>

<h3><u>Given Information :-</u></h3>

  • <u>Number ➢</u> 167 300

<h3><u>To Find :-</u></h3>

  • In which number does 7 represent 10 times the value that it represents in 167 300.

  • 215,007
  • 392,070
  • 450,700
  • 572,000
  • 791,000

<h3><u>Calculation :-</u></h3>

In the given number, we can observe that, the face value of digit 7 is on 'Thousands place'. If multiply 7, 10 times, the face value of digit 7 will shift to it's Left Side by 1 digit, since, this condition is seen in the 4th option provided, hence, option 4. 572,000 is the correct answer.

<h3>____________________</h3>

<h2><u>Final Answer :-</u></h2>

Option 4. 572,000 is the correct answer

Inequality to x2 &lt; 64
Anarel [89]
              NOT MY WORDS TAKEN FROM A SOURCE!

(x^2) <64  => (x^2) -64 < 64-64 => (x^2) - 64 < 0 64= 8^2    so    (x^2) - (8^2) < 0  To solve the inequality we first find the roots (values of x that make (x^2) - (8^2) = 0 ) Note that if we can express (x^2) - (y^2) as (x-y)* (x+y)  You can work backwards and verify this is true. so let's set (x^2) - (8^2)  equal to zero to find the roots: (x^2) - (8^2) = 0   => (x-8)*(x+8) = 0       if x-8 = 0 => x=8      and if x+8 = 0 => x=-8 So x= +/-8 are the roots of x^2) - (8^2)Now you need to pick any x values less than -8 (the smaller root) , one x value between -8 and +8 (the two roots), and one x value greater than 8 (the greater root) and see if the sign is positive or negative. 1) Let's pick -10 (which is smaller than -8). If x=-10, then (x^2) - (8^2) = 100-64 = 36>0  so it is positive
2) Let's pick 0 (which is greater than -8, larger than 8). If x=0, then (x^2) - (8^2) = 0-64 = -64 <0  so it is negative3) Let's pick +10 (which is greater than 10). If x=-10, then (x^2) - (8^2) = 100-64 = 36>0  so it is positive Since we are interested in (x^2) - 64 < 0, then x should be between -8 and positive 8. So  -8<x<8 Note: If you choose any number outside this range for x, and square it it will be greater than 64 and so it is not valid.
